                  Liverpool manager Brendan Rodgers determined not to lose Martin Skrtel
                  Brendan Rodgers is determined to resist any attempt to lure Martin Skrtel from Liverpool, insisting there have been no bids for the defender.

                  Skrtel suggested in an interview last week he has received several offers to leave. That is news to Rodgers.
                  Liverpool hope to conclude negotiations on a new deal with the 27 year-old and are bemused by suggestions there has been any breakdown in those conversations.
                  The club expects talks to continue in the coming weeks.
                  Skrtel featured in the opening game of Rodgers’ reign in Canada on Saturday, a low-key 1-1 draw with Toronto, and the Liverpool manager said he would fight to keep his centre-back.
                  Asked if there had been offers for the defender, Rodgers said: “No. I’ve heard nothing from any other club. Martin has been fantastic and seems happy and contented. He fits into my plans and ideas. I will fight as hard as I can to keep the players that I want here and he is one of them.

                  “Unfortunately there is always that rumour, speculation and gossip and until the window closes that will continue.”

                  It had seemed Skrtel would be remaining on Merseyside until the comments published in an interview in his own country.
